Give an example of what a worldview is

2024-09-16 12:16
1 answer

Worldview usually referred to the basic structure and rules of a fictional world, including its history, culture, geography, politics, economy, etc., as well as the behavior and interaction of various creatures, species, and humans in this world. A typical worldview can be seen as a framework composed of a series of rules and restrictions. These rules can affect the various elements of the fictional world, including people, places, things, and so on. The world view could be regarded as the foundation of novels, anime, games, and other fictional works because it provided the basic background and setting of the world, making it easier for readers or audiences to understand the background and situation of the story.

What is a Gothic novel and give an example?

3 answers
2024-10-08 09:44

A Gothic novel is a type of literature that often features elements like haunted castles, supernatural elements, and mysterious, brooding characters. An example is 'Frankenstein' by Mary Shelley.

What is non-fiction and give an example?

3 answers
2024-10-05 12:58

Non-fiction is writing based on real facts and events. An example could be a biography of a famous person like 'Steve Jobs' by Walter Isaacson.

What is fiction writing and give an example?

2 answers
2024-09-29 02:00

Fiction writing is creating stories and characters that are not based on real events. For example, 'Harry Potter' is a fictional story set in a magical world.
